Request a Tutor كن مدرسًا خصوصيًا
x

بايثون مدرسون خصوصيون في مصر

اعثر على أفضل مدرسي بايثون في مصر، الذين يقدمون دروسًا فردية وشخصية لمساعدتك على تحسين درجاتك. احصل على مساعدة من مدرسي بايثون لدينا في التحضير للاختبارات والمساعدة في الواجبات المنزلية.

تم العثور على 0 بايثون مدرس

بايثون هي لغة برمجة حاسوبية عامة الأغراض وعالية المستوى، طُوِّرت بواسطة غيدو فان روسوم عام ١٩٩١. تُستخدم هذه اللغة في تطوير البرمجيات، ومواقع الويب، وكتابة البرامج النصية للأنظمة. تتميز ببنية بسيطة تُشبه اللغة الإنجليزية. تستطيع بايثون التعامل مع كميات كبيرة من البيانات، وإجراء عمليات حسابية معقدة، وتحرير الملفات. إذا كنت ترغب في اكتساب المزيد من المعرفة حول بايثون، فإن الاستعانة بمُدرِّب بايثون مُحترف في مصر أمرٌ لا غنى عنه.

مدرسون خصوصيون عبر الإنترنت لـ البرمجة عرض الكل

عرض جميع المدرسين الخصوصيين عبر الإنترنت

الأسئلة الشائعة

👉 ما هي أفضل الموارد المتاحة عبر الإنترنت للمبتدئين لتعلم لغة بايثون؟

هناك العديد من الموارد الرائعة المتاحة عبر الإنترنت للمبتدئين الذين يرغبون في تعلم لغة بايثون. إليك بعضًا من أفضلها:

  • Codecademy: تقدم هذه المنصة دروسًا تفاعلية في البرمجة تُعلّمك أساسيات لغة بايثون.
  • Python.org: يوفر الموقع الرسمي للغة بايثون دروسًا تعليمية، ووثائق، ومنتدى نشطًا للمجتمع.
  • edX: منصة مجانية تقدم دورات بايثون من جامعات مرموقة مثل معهد ماساتشوستس للتكنولوجيا وجامعة هارفارد.
  • Coursera: منصة مدفوعة تقدم دورات بايثون يُدرّسها مدربون ذوو خبرة.
  • SoloLearn: تطبيق جوال يوفر دروسًا قصيرة في بايثون يُمكن إكمالها أثناء التنقل.
  • YouTube: يوجد عدد لا يُحصى من فيديوهات تعليم بايثون على يوتيوب، بما في ذلك فيديوهات من قنوات شهيرة مثل Corey Schafer وSentdex.
  • HackerRank: موقع إلكتروني يوفر تحديات وتمارين برمجية لصقل مهاراتك في لغة بايثون.
  • DataCamp: منصة مدفوعة تقدم دورات في لغة بايثون مع التركيز على علم البيانات والتعلم الآلي.

👉 كيف يمكنني جعل كود بايثون الخاص بي أكثر كفاءة وتحسينًا؟

هناك العديد من التقنيات التي يمكن استخدامها لتحسين كفاءة كود بايثون. إليك بعض الاستراتيجيات الرئيسية:

  • استخدم الدوال والمكتبات المدمجة: تحتوي بايثون على العديد من الدوال والمكتبات المدمجة المُحسّنة للسرعة، لذا يُفضّل غالبًا استخدامها بدلًا من كتابة كود مخصص.
  • تجنّب العمليات الحسابية غير الضرورية: لا تُجرِ عمليات حسابية غير ضرورية. يمكن أن يساعد هذا في توفير وقت المعالجة والذاكرة.
  • استخدم تراكيب القوائم والمولدات: قد تكون هذه أكثر كفاءة من استخدام الحلقات التقليدية للتكرار على البيانات.
  • تجنب المتغيرات العامة: قد يؤدي استخدام المتغيرات العامة إلى إبطاء التعليمات البرمجية، لذا من الأفضل تجنبها قدر الإمكان.
  • استخدم أدوات تحليل الأداء: يمكن أن تساعدك أدوات تحليل الأداء في تحديد نقاط الاختناق في الأداء وتحسين التعليمات البرمجية.
  • فكّر في استخدام لغة مُصرّفة: إذا كنت بحاجة إلى أداء أسرع، ففكّر في استخدام لغة مُصرّفة مثل C أو C++ للأجزاء الحساسة للأداء في التعليمات البرمجية.

من خلال تطبيق هذه التقنيات، يمكنك جعل كود بايثون الخاص بك أكثر كفاءة وتحسينًا.

👉 ما هي أفضل الممارسات لتوثيق كود بايثون؟

التوثيق عنصر أساسي في كتابة كود بايثون قابل للصيانة وإعادة الاستخدام. إليك بعض أفضل الممارسات لتوثيق كود بايثون:

  • استخدم سلاسل التوثيق: استخدم سلاسل التوثيق لوصف الغرض من الدوال والفئات والوحدات البرمجية وسلوكها.
  • يجب أن تكون سلاسل التوثيق موجزة وواضحة وتتبع تنسيقًا متسقًا. اتبع إرشادات PEP 8: اتبع إرشادات PEP 8 لأسلوب كتابة الكود، والتي تتضمن توصيات لتنسيق سلاسل التوثيق. استخدم التعليقات باعتدال: استخدم التعليقات لشرح الكود المعقد أو المُربك، ولكن تجنب الإفراط في استخدامها لأنها قد تُسبب ازدحامًا في الكود. حدّث التوثيق بانتظام: حافظ على تحديث التوثيق بما يتماشى مع تغييرات الكود، حتى يظل ذا صلة. استخدم الأدوات: استخدم أدوات مثل Sphinx لإنشاء التوثيق من سلاسل التوثيق تلقائيًا. قدّم أمثلة على الاستخدام: قدّم أمثلة لكيفية استخدام الدوال والوحدات النمطية. باتباع أفضل الممارسات هذه، يمكنك إنشاء توثيق واضح وغني بالمعلومات يجعل الكود الخاص بك أكثر سهولة في الوصول إليه وأسهل في الصيانة.

     

👉 ما هي أفضل طريقة للبدء في تحليل البيانات باستخدام لغة بايثون؟

للبدء في تحليل البيانات باستخدام بايثون، اتبع الخطوات التالية:

  • تعلم أساسيات بايثون: قبل الخوض في تحليل البيانات، يجب أن يكون لديك فهم جيد لبنية بايثون، وهياكل البيانات، وتدفق التحكم.
  • تعلم مكتبات تحليل البيانات: تعلم مكتبات تحليل البيانات الشائعة مثل NumPy وPandas وMatplotlib. تتيح لك هذه المكتبات معالجة البيانات وعرضها بكفاءة.
  • تدرب على مجموعات بيانات حقيقية: ابحث عن مجموعات بيانات متاحة للعموم وتدرب على استخدام أدوات تحليل البيانات عليها.
  • يُعدّ Kaggle مصدرًا ممتازًا للعثور على مجموعات بيانات حقيقية للعمل عليها. تعلم الأساليب الإحصائية: تعلّم الأساليب والمفاهيم الإحصائية الأساسية مثل الإحصاء الوصفي، واختبار الفرضيات، والانحدار الخطي. التحق بدورة تدريبية أو احصل على شهادة: هناك العديد من الدورات التدريبية والشهادات عبر الإنترنت التي يمكن أن تساعدك في تعلم تحليل البيانات باستخدام لغة بايثون، مثل DataCamp أو Coursera. باتباع هذه الخطوات، يمكنك البدء في تحليل البيانات باستخدام لغة بايثون واستكشاف عالم تحليل البيانات الواسع.

     

👉 ما هي أفضل الطرق لممارسة لغة بايثون والحفاظ على مهاراتي حادة؟

للحفاظ على مهاراتك في لغة بايثون قوية، إليك عدة طرق يمكنك من خلالها التدرب وتحسين مهاراتك: ... للتفاعل مع مطورين آخرين والتعلم منهم. اقرأ وساهم في مشاريع مفتوحة المصدر: قراءة مشاريع مفتوحة المصدر والمساهمة فيها يساعدك على التعلم من مطورين ذوي خبرة وتحسين مهاراتك البرمجية. احضر مؤتمرات ولقاءات بايثون: احضر مؤتمرات ولقاءات بايثون لتتعرف على التقنيات الجديدة وأفضل الممارسات من مطورين ذوي خبرة. بالممارسة المنتظمة ومواكبة أحدث الاتجاهات والتقنيات، يمكنك تحسين مهاراتك في بايثون والبقاء في طليعة هذا المجال.

 

👉 ما هي بعض الاستراتيجيات الجيدة لتصحيح أخطاء كود بايثون الخاص بي؟

يُعدّ تصحيح الأخطاء جزءًا أساسيًا من كتابة أكواد بايثون، وفيما يلي بعض الاستراتيجيات التي تُساعدك في تصحيح أخطاء كود بايثون الخاص بك:

  • استخدم عبارات الطباعة: يُساعدك إدراج عبارات الطباعة في الكود على فهم تدفق البرنامج وقيم المتغيرات المختلفة في كل خطوة.
  • استخدم مُصحِّح الأخطاء: تُساعدك مُصحِّحات الأخطاء مثل pdb ومُصحِّح أخطاء PyCharm على تتبُّع الكود سطرًا بسطر، وتعيين نقاط توقف، وفحص قيم المتغيرات.
  • اقرأ رسائل الخطأ: اقرأ رسائل الخطأ بعناية وافهم ما تُشير إليه بشأن الكود.
  • استخدم اختبارات الوحدة: تُساعدك كتابة اختبارات الوحدة على تحديد الأخطاء في الكود بسرعة.
  • بسِّط الكود: بسّط الكود لعزل المشكلة والتركيز عليها.
  • اطلب المساعدة: إذا كنت لا تزال تواجه صعوبة، فاطلب المساعدة من زملائك، عبر الإنترنت المنتديات، أو مجتمعات مثل Stack Overflow.

باتباع هذه الاستراتيجيات، يمكنك تصحيح أخطاء كود بايثون الخاص بك بشكل أكثر فعالية وتحديد الأخطاء وإصلاحها بسرعة أكبر.

👉 كيف يمكن لمدرسي لغة بايثون لدينا المساعدة في الدراسة؟

يمكن أن يكون مدرسو لغة بايثون مفيدين للغاية للطلاب الذين يدرسون لغة بايثون. إليك بعض الطرق التي يمكن أن يساعدك بها مدرس بايثون: ... التعلم.

بشكل عام، يمكن لمدرس لغة بايثون أن يقدم دعمًا وتوجيهًا قيّمين للطلاب أثناء سعيهم لتحسين مهاراتهم في بايثون وتحقيق أهدافهم الأكاديمية والمهنية.

تنصل: MyPrivateTutor عبارة عن منصة تعليمية ومجتمع يربط الطلاب بمعلمين ومدربين أكفاء. نحن لا نوفر معلمين للطلاب، ولا نختار أو نقترح معلمين محددين للطلاب أو الطلاب. لا تتحقق MyPrivateTutor من هوية أو معلومات المعلمين أو الطلاب المنشورة. يرجى مراجعة مركز الأمان للاطلاع على إرشادات حول كيفية التحقق من هوية ومعلومات المستخدمين الآخرين.